What eye care services are typically offered by optometrists in Glen Carbon?

Optometrists in Glen Carbon provide comprehensive eye exams to diagnose vision issues like nearsightedness, farsightedness, and astigmatism. They also manage and treat conditions such as dry eye, glaucoma, and diabetic eye disease. Most practices offer contact lens fittings, including for specialty lenses, and provide a wide selection of eyewear. Given the area's demographics, many optometrists here also specialize in pediatric eye care and management of age-related conditions like cataracts and macular degeneration.

Finding the Right Pediatric Optometrist Near Me in Glen Carbon, IL

As a parent in Glen Carbon, IL, your child's health and development are top priorities, and their vision is a critical part of that. Searching for a "pediatric optometrist near me" is about more than just proximity; it's about finding a specialist who understands the unique visual needs of children in our community. Early eye exams are essential, as many vision problems can be corrected more easily when detected young. A pediatric optometrist is specifically trained to work with children, using age-appropriate techniques and equipment to make the experience positive and stress-free.

When looking for a pediatric optometrist in Glen Carbon, consider their approach to young patients. A good specialist will create a welcoming environment, perhaps with a kid-friendly waiting area, and will explain procedures in a way that puts your child at ease. They are skilled in assessing visual skills crucial for learning, such as eye tracking, focusing, and teaming—abilities that directly impact reading and classroom performance. For families in our area, with children attending schools in the Edwardsville District 7 or other local systems, ensuring these visual foundations are strong is a key step in supporting academic success.

Practical tips for your search include checking if the optometrist accepts your family's vision insurance plan and understanding their recommended exam schedule. The American Optometric Association suggests a first comprehensive eye exam at 6 months, another at age 3, and again before starting kindergarten. After that, annual exams are typically advised, especially if there's a family history of vision issues. Given Glen Carbon's active lifestyle, with kids playing sports at Miner Park or spending time on screens, discuss these habits with the eye doctor. They can offer advice on protective eyewear for sports and managing digital eye strain.
